Top 10 Unusual Health Conditions That Exist

Explore the top 10 unusual and bizarre health conditions that exist, ranging from Alien Hand Syndrome to Foreign Body Syndrome. Discover the fascinating complexities of the human body

In the vast spectrum of human health, there are several conditions that exist which can be classified as unusual or even bizarre.

These conditions, though rare, shed light on the incredible complexity of the human body and the countless ways it can manifest illness. In this article, we will explore ten of these unusual health conditions, ranging from the peculiar to the downright extraordinary.

1. Alien Hand Syndrome

Alien Hand Syndrome, also known as Dr. Strangelove Syndrome, is a rare neurological disorder that causes a person’s hand to take on a life of its own.

Affected individuals may experience involuntary movements, such as reaching out to grab objects without conscious intent or even unbuttoning clothes against the individual’s will.

2. Jumping Frenchmen of Maine

Jumping Frenchmen of Maine is a phenomenon characterized by an exaggerated startle reflex. Those affected may exhibit extreme reactions to sudden stimuli, such as flailing their limbs, shouting, or even obeying commands without question.

This condition was first observed among a group of French-Canadian lumberjacks.

3. Foreign Accent Syndrome

Foreign Accent Syndrome is a rare condition in which individuals suddenly begin to speak in a foreign accent, despite never having learned the language.

This condition can be caused by brain trauma or neurological damage and often leads to profound social and psychological effects for the affected person.

4. Body Integrity Identity Disorder

Body Integrity Identity Disorder, also known as Apotemnophilia, is a rare psychological condition in which individuals feel that one or more of their limbs do not belong to their body.

Some individuals with this condition may engage in self-harming behaviors to achieve amputation of the desired limb.

5. Exploding Head Syndrome

Exploding Head Syndrome is a sleep disorder characterized by the perception of a loud noise or explosion during sleep onset or awakening.

The sensation is typically described as a sudden, loud bang or crashing sound that can be incredibly distressing, but is not associated with any physical pain.

6. Progeria

Progeria, also known as Hutchinson-Gilford Progeria Syndrome, is a rare genetic condition that causes rapid aging in children.

Affected individuals have an accelerated aging process, leading to several health complications, cardiovascular problems, and a significantly shortened lifespan.

7. Hypertrichosis

Hypertrichosis, also known as “werewolf syndrome,” is an abnormal amount of hair growth over the body. This condition can be localized or generalized, causing excessive hair growth in areas such as the face, arms, or back.

Hypertrichosis can be either congenital or acquired later in life.

8. Stendhal Syndrome

Stendhal Syndrome, also known as Florence Syndrome, is a psychosomatic disorder characterized by rapid heartbeat, dizziness, and even hallucinations when exposed to particularly beautiful works of art or awe-inspiring environments.

The sheer intensity of the experience can be overwhelming for those affected.

9. Walking Corpse Syndrome

Walking Corpse Syndrome, or Cotard’s Syndrome, is a rare psychiatric disorder in which a person believes they are dead, non-existent, or that their organs are missing or decaying.

These delusions can make individuals deny basic biological needs and even attempt self-harm due to the conviction that they are already deceased.

10. Foreign Body Syndrome

Foreign Body Syndrome is a psychological condition in which individuals believe that an object or foreign body is inside them, despite medical examinations providing evidence to the contrary.

Sufferers may undergo unnecessary surgeries, insist on scans, or even resort to self-inflicted injuries to prove the presence of the imagined foreign object.

Conclusion

These ten unusual health conditions exemplify the vast and mysterious array of abnormalities that can affect the human body and mind.

From strange neurological disorders to rare genetic conditions and bewildering psychosomatic disorders, these conditions not only challenge our understanding of human health but also inspire further research and compassion towards those who live with them.
